It is a bit interesting how going to a decent chinees/japanese restaurant can open a new world in something other than food. A local place serves oolong tea with their meals, and it amazed me that I could drink a tea that lacked a load of sweetener to make it drinkable. So I asked what it was. "vulong" is what I got out of the waitress when I asked, so I went searching. While I did find that vulong was really oolong, I found some other tea's I enjoy as well.
While I am still figuring out how to brew the tea in more than tiny amounts (which would be fine while sitting at home, at work I don't have a range of choices for how to make it) Maybe one day I'll manage to make oolong as good as the chinees place, I've still not quite mastered the secret.
Still, I refuse to give up and will keep at it.
As a side note, I've come to love rooibos almost as much.
